Brief Description of Duties:
The incumbent directs the day-to-day operations of the Clinical Research Core, developing, managing, and evaluating all administrative and financial policies and procedures of the office. Responsible for developing position descriptions, hiring, training, supervising, performing yearly reviews, etc. Provides expertise, training, and mentoring to research staff, not limited to Investigators and Study Coordinators. Facilitates study start up (budget development, contract negotiation, administrative approvals, etc.), as well as manages financial aspects of industry funded clinical trials for a number of departments within the SOM. Establishes collaborative processes and shared resources among other SUNY campuses with the goal of identifying common needs. Reports directly to the Associate Director for Clinical Trials at Stony Brook School of Medicine.

Duties:

Staff/Personnel Responsibilities:
• Supervises CRC staff, providing specific work assignments to staff in order to facilitate research at SBU, performing QA on assigned work, carrying out performance programs reviews and evaluations, managing time off requests, etc.
• Ensure that policies and procedures are adhered to.
• Trains and mentors' staff (PI's, department administrators, Study Coordinators, etc.) on research-related practices.
• Facilitates educational research training to study coordinators throughout the year.

Financial Responsibilities:
• Budget development and negotiation for industry-funded clinical trials for SOM.
• Payment Terms negotiation with sponsors.
• Management of Clinical Conductor Clinical Trails Management System (CTMS). Creation of new studies and their negotiated budget
• Training of Study Coordinators on the use of the CTMS.
• Provide technical support to users of CTMS.
• Run monthly financial reports and queries for data entry.
• Study invoicing, payments, accounts reconciliation, and closeout.

Other:
• Oversees regulatory aspects of studies, such as IRB submission and ClinicalTrials.gov entries for research compliance.
• Day-to-Day study coordination, including patient recruitment and consent, study visits, collection, preparation, shipping of human samples, and data entry.
• Preparation of necessary documents, figures, and tables for research presentations, Data and Safety Monitoring Board meetings, and sponsor audits.
